Abstract
The rapid evolution of technology, particularly in artificial intelligence (AI), is reshaping the global job market at an unprecedented pace. This transformative wave presents challenges and opportunities, especially for the United Arab Emirates (UAE), as it endeavours to future-proof its workforce. This article examines the imperative of upskilling and reskilling as a strategic response to the dynamic demands of the contemporary job landscape in the UAE. Focusing on the pivotal role of AI skills, the paper explores the current state of the UAE workforce, highlighting the vulnerabilities of existing job roles and industries to technological disruptions. The global context of upskilling initiatives provides a backdrop to understand the urgency of this issue and offers insights into successful implementation strategies.
